Preparation
- In a large pan, heat a splash of olive oil over medium heat.
- Toss the diced chicken into the pan and cook until nicely browned.
-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the pan and sauté for 2-3 minutes.
- Stir in the diced bell pepper and sprinkle over the Italian seasoning. Mix until coated.
- Pour in the BBQ sauce and honey, scraping the bottom of the pan to incorporate caramelized bits.
- Add penne pasta and two cups of water to the pan, stir well, cover, and let it simmer for about 12 minutes, or until the pasta is al dente.
- Check for doneness at the 10-minute mark; if the pasta is getting too soft, remove from heat.
- Once done, remove the pan from heat and let it sit for a couple of minutes before serving.
